The Northern Lights Lodge by Julie Caplin
Did not finish book. Stopped at 23%.
Did not finish book. Stopped at 23%.
This book was just too sad. I don't like it when the MC loses EVERYTHING, and Lucy had - her job, her apartment, her self-respect, her peace of mind, literally everything. The author kept alluding to what had happened, and it seemed like perhaps something s3xual at work that was videoed.
I could maybe deal with that, except for all the horrible things that I can already tell are going to be part of the plot: there's a crew filming the lodge of a reality TV segment, and Lucy is panicking that ppl will Google her and realize who she is because of her mysterious video that got her fired. Someone is stealing things from the hotel. The love interest, Alex, is working for the new buyer and is basically lying to her about who he is, which means she will end up feels up betrayed by him. There is just literally nothing going right and too much going wrong for me to want to invest in it. I started reading with a ton of apprehension and I'm not looking for that in a book
I'd be much more interested in a story about Hekla, one of the employees at the lodge

Prince of Song & Sea by Linsey Miller

This was such a great story!! I loved the intrigue into Eric's backstory. The only "problem" was that it did feel like the original Disney story was shoe-horned into the book.
But I loved how the author added to Ariel's personality while she was on land, as well as how she fleshed out Ariel's and Eric's relationship.
